10. Storage

m CAUTION
Never put a chain saw into storage for longer than 30 days without carrying out the following steps.
Follow the cleaning instructions and maintenance instructions before storing the device.
Storing a chain saw
Storing a chain saw for longer than 30 days requires storage maintenance. Unless the storage instructions are followed,
fuel remaining in the carburetor will evaporate, leaving gum-like deposits. This could lead to difficult starting and result in
costly repairs.
• Remove the fuel tank cap slowly to release any pressure in tank. Carefully drain the fuel tank.
• Start the engine and let it run until the unit stops to remove fuel from carburetor.
• Allow the engine to cool (approx. 5 minutes).
• Remove the spark plug.
• Pour 1 teaspoon of clean 2-cycle oil into the combustion chamber. Pull starter rope slowly several times to coat in-
ternal components. Replace spark plug.
m NOTE
Store the unit in a dry place and away from possible sources of ignition such as a furnace, gas hot water heater, gas dry-
er, etc.
Puttig the saw back into operation
• Remove spark plug.
• Pull starter rope briskly to clear excess oil from combustion chamber.
• Clean the spark plug and check that the electrode gap is correct.
• Prepare unit for operation.
• Fill fuel tank with proper fuel / oil mixture.
11. Disposal and recycling
The unit is supplied in packaging to prevent its being damaged in transit. This packaging is raw material and can there-
fore be reused or can be returned to the raw material system.
The unit and its accessories are made of various types of material, such as metal and plastic. Defective components
must be disposed of as special waste. Ask about recycling in the store or in the local municipal administration!
